Output 83d6d5e24b64c219d2468ea33337409fb38a48886c960819690587575de958e1:114

value
20164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d2f73eb390fe8afa0aee30e15b8b76e3930b2ad OP_EQUAL
address
3G28rjsiB37Rw7TsU6KAsgMTHJxj5h9syr
transaction
83d6d5e24b64c219d2468ea33337409fb38a48886c960819690587575de958e1
confirmations
143049
spent
true